A New Zealand Stag in native bush
The stag and his large stature has a majestic and powerful presence much like the rich symbolic tapestry of his meanings through various cultures and mythologies.
He is a symbol of strength, nobility and protection. The stag also represents a deep spiritual connection through myth he is often depicted as a messenger or guide to the spiritual realm towards spiritual enlightenment or a quest for wisdom.
His antlers are a symbol or rebirth and rejuvenation with the annual shedding regrowth which replicates the cyclical nature of life, death and rebirth. A symbol of renewal and the overcoming of obstacles.
